What is Cafe Mambo famous for?

It’s arguably the most famous sunset café in the world, the heartbeat of Ibiza’s legendary pre-party scene and the home of Radio 1’s White Isle broadcast since 1997.

What’s the minimum spend at Café Mambo?

To book a table in advance at Café Mambo, it is required that your group agree to a minimum spend of €150 per person for a VIP table, €100 per person for a seafront table and €70 per person for a regular terrace table.

Does Café Mambo serve food?

Café Mambo offers 3 distinct menus for breakfast, lunch and dinner, starting the day from 10:00 with popular items such as Full English breakfasts, Eggs Benedict or Eggs Royale and smashed avocado. At lunchtime, salads and poké bowls take over, accompanied by gourmet burgers, wraps and sandwiches.

Which lane is famous in Goa?

Located in Calangute, Tito’s is one of the most famous nightclubs in Goa. Founded in 1971 by Tito Henry de Souza, the pub is synonymous with Goa’s nightlife. The entire lane in Baga, where the pub is located is popularly called Tito lane.

Is Café Mambo open all year round?

Is Café Mambo open all year round? The Ibiza party season generally starts in May, with opening parties around the island for a few weeks, and ends early October. Café Mambo is no exception – open between May and October every year.
